Reasons to Automate Your Website Asset Backup
Automating your website asset backups provides data security, efficiency, consistency, cost savings, and peace of mind.
- Data Security: Automated backups help protect your digital assets from accidental loss, hacking attempts, or system failures.
- Time Efficiency: Automating backups saves time and human resources, allowing you to focus on core business activities.
- Consistency: Scheduled automated backups minimize the risk of outdated or incomplete asset copies.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Reducing the risk of data loss eliminates potential recovery expenses.

Step-by-Step Guide to Build Your Backup Workflow
1.
Connect Your Website to n8n
Create a new workflow in n8n and select a trigger node for scheduled backups.
2.
Choose Your Backup Destination
Integrate Google Drive, AWS S3, Dropbox, and GitHub as your backup destinations.
3.
Define What to Backup
Select the types of assets to backup, including databases, files, and content.
4.
Testing Your Workflow
Execute the workflow manually to check that all components are functioning correctly.
5.
Schedule and Automate
Use the scheduling feature in n8n to automate your backup workflow on a defined timeline.
